Is there a way to fix 0xc0000005 Error? Please tell me
Sure! Here’s how to fix the 0xc0000005 error in simple steps:
- Run a full antivirus scan to remove malware.
- Update your device drivers via Device Manager.
- Check for Windows updates and install them.
- Run System File Checker: Open Command Prompt as admin, type
sfc /scannow
, and press Enter. - Perform a system restore to a previous point if the error persists.
- Reinstall the problematic software if it relates to a specific application.

To fix the 0xc0000005 error:
- Restart your PC
- Run Windows Memory Diagnostic
- Update or reinstall device drivers
- Disable DEP (Data Execution Prevention)
- Scan for malware
- Perform System Restore or reinstall Windows if needed
